你查询的IP:[116.4.203.38]  地理位置:中国–广东–东莞

最新查询60.55.27.106 58.14.82.47 117.21.27.69 203.95.183.0 117.24.75.97 119.2.237.22 124.29.89.77 59.64.23.230 119.254.95.0 116.4.203.38 203.128.32.208 117.8.50.213 116.58.128.18 122.112.191.125 119.19.50.78 123.180.98.114 202.127.160.234 120.80.107.39 114.28.43.194 202.160.176.117 119.248.7.206 116.215.130.114 60.255.238.22 119.32.174.98 118.80.33.72 60.247.73.49 120.80.201.4 202.38.156.127 124.200.92.95 202.122.32.185 203.191.64.47